is an artillery fort originally constructed by Henry VIII in in Kent, between 1539 and 1540. It formed part of the King's Device programme to protect England against invasion from France and the Holy Roman Empire, and defended a vulnerable point along the coast. is situated 1 mile south of All Soul’s Church of England Primary School.
